Video headlines
As well as the latest new stories in text, you can also watch video headlines on your mobile phone.
The two to three minute summary from BBC News 24 is updated throughout the day with the latest news stories from around the world.
To access the video headlines go to BBC News on your mobile by either texting NEWS to 81010 or by going to bbc.co.uk/news on your handset and click the video headlines link.
